Synopsis "Lettres De Madame Du Montier, A La Marquise De *** Sa Fille, Avec Les RÃ(c)ponses... [par Mme Le Prince De Beaumont]... (in French)"

Lettres De Madame Du Montier, A La Marquise De *** Sa Fille, Avec Les RÃ(c)ponses... presents a fascinating glimpse into the lives and perspectives of women in 18th-century France. Attributed to Jeanne-Marie Leprince de Beaumont, this collection of letters offers insights into the social customs, family dynamics, and personal reflections of the era. The correspondence between Madame du Montier and her daughter provides a rich tapestry of observations on subjects ranging from morality and education to marriage and societal expectations.Through their exchanges, the reader gains a unique understanding of the challenges and opportunities facing women within the French aristocracy. The letters serve as both a literary work and a valuable historical document, shedding light on the intellectual and emotional landscape of the time.
